Tragic Suicide of Accountant in Jaipur Sparks Investigation

Incident Overview

In a heartbreaking incident late Saturday night, a 56-year-old accountant named Ghisalal Sharma, who worked at the Secretariat, took his own life in the Karni Vihar area. Prior to his death, he penned a three-page suicide note and shared a photo of it in a community WhatsApp group.


Police Response

Upon receiving the report, police arrived at the scene, retrieved the body, and sent it to the Kanwatia Hospital morgue for an autopsy. According to the investigating officer, Sub-Inspector Kaluram, the deceased lived with his wife in Rajni Vihar. Their two sons, Himanshu and Yash, are employed in Gujarat and Gurugram, respectively.


Family's Reaction

On Sunday morning, family members received the suicide note and the WhatsApp message, prompting them to rush home. They found the room locked from the inside, and upon breaking down the door, discovered Ghisalal hanging.


Investigation Details

The police have seized the suicide note. Initial investigations suggest that Ghisalal had been struggling with family disputes and issues related to his in-laws. The note explicitly detailed his mental state and the pressures he faced from his family.


Ongoing Inquiry

Authorities are conducting further inquiries with family members and relatives to ascertain the reasons behind this tragic event. The body has been handed over to the family after a post-mortem examination by a medical board.
